I'd say that this camera is limited at best. It's only a three megapixel camera and I think that no comercial stock agency - like someone making calendars - would even look at such work. I've heard of people interpolating the shots to make them bigger but I wonder how stupid they think the agencies are. Once glance that the EXIF information would tell them what's going on.
Anyway, here's the thing. You need a better camera if you are trying to do professional work. If I'm doing a lecture to university students who are involved with photography for fun, I won't "demand" that they have better gear just because it's their hobby. But when I talk to photography students I tell them the truth, and that is they need a certain level of equipment.
So save your money and buy something like a used 10D and a decent lens.
